云打包工具
云打包工具,顾名思义,就是将多个文件或者文件夹打包成一个文件,并上传到云端进行存储,以便于分享或备份。它主要是为了解决文件过大、传输速度慢、存储空间不足等问题而设计的。云打包工具的原理可以分为两个部分:打包和上传。1. 打包打包是指将多个文件或文件夹打包成一个文件,以便于传输和存储。打包的过程中,需...
2023-10-27 围观 : 3次
在当今数字化时代,移动端设备(如智能手机、平板电脑、手持设备等)已经成为人们生活和工作中必不可少的一部分。因此,许多企业和组织都开始意识到建立自己的移动应用程序,以便更好地与客户和用户进行互动,并提供更好的用户体验。在这篇文章中,我们将探讨如何将现有的网站转换为移动应用程序。
对于Web开发人员来说,转换现有网站为移动应用程序的过程并不难理解,因为它与网站开发过程非常相似。然而,这种转换需要开发人员掌握一定的移动应用程序开发知识和技术。下面是一些关键步骤:
1. 确定功能和需求
在开始开发移动应用之前,要确定具体的功能和需求。你可以考虑列出一个详细的需求清单,并与你的团队和客户一起讨论和确认。这样可以确保你的移动应用包含必要的功能和特性,并针对不同的用户需求进行了优化。
2. 选择适当的开发平台
根据应用程序类型和功能需求,开发团队要选择适当的平台,例如iOS、Android、Windows Phone等。这取决于你要开发的应用程序的目标受众,以及目标受众使用的设备类型。选择正确的平台可以确保应用程序在不同设备上的良好性能和用户体验。
3. 设计用户界面
对于移动应用程序,用户界面的设计非常重要。一个好的界面可以让用户更容易地使用应用程序,并提高用户满意度。因此,在设计用户界面时,你应该考虑以下因素:
- 移动设备的屏幕大小和分辨率
- 可用的交互操作(如触摸屏、手势)
- 设计元素和颜色
- 内容的排版和布局
4. 开发应用程序
一旦确定了功能、需求、平台和用户界面设计,就可以开始开发应用程序了。开发应用程序时,可以使用一些开发工具和框架,例如Ionic和React Native等。这些工具和框架可以帮助你减少编码工作量,提高开发效率。
5. 进行测试和优化
完成开发后,需要对应用程序进行测试和优化。应该在各种设备上测试应用程序,以确保其在不同的设备上具有一致的性能和用户体验。应用程序的性能可以通过优化代码和使用适当的算法来提高。
6. 发布应用程序
应用程序完成测试后,就可以发布到应用商店中。发布应用程序需要遵循苹果和谷歌等平台的规定,例如应用程序的图标、描述和截图等。
在总结中,转换现有网站为移动应用程序需要考虑多个因素,包括功能需求、平台选择、用户界面设计、开发、测试和发布等。通过理解这些步骤和技术,你可以将你的网站转换成一个优秀的移动应用程序,并为用户提供良好的体验。
云打包工具,顾名思义,就是将多个文件或者文件夹打包成一个文件,并上传到云端进行存储,以便于分享或备份。它主要是为了解决文件过大、传输速度慢、存储空间不足等问题而设计的。云打包工具的原理可以分为两个部分:打包和上传。1. 打包打包是指将多个文件或文件夹打包成一个文件,以便于传输和存储。打包的过程中,需...
Webpack是一个现代化的JavaScript应用程序的静态模块打包器,它将多个JavaScript文件打包成一个或多个bundle文件,从而减少了页面中需要加载的文件数量。除了JavaScript,Webpack还可以处理CSS、图片等文件,使得开发者可以在一个项目中使用多种类型的文件。在打包网...
随着智能手机的普及,越来越多的人开始使用应用程序来满足他们的需求。而对于一些人来说,自制应用程序可能是一个有趣的挑战。在本文中,我们将介绍如何自制一个Android应用程序的APK文件。APK是Android应用程序的安装包。它包含了应用程序的所有文件和代码,以及安装应用所需的信息。在Android...
软件开发框架是一种提供了一系列通用功能的软件架构,它可以帮助开发人员更快速、更高效地构建应用程序。开发框架通常包括一组标准化的库、模板、工具和API,这些工具可以帮助开发人员实现常见的编程任务,从而使他们能够更专注于应用程序的业务逻辑和功能。下面是几种常见的软件开发框架:1. Java Spring...
Android 13(也称为Android S)是预计在2022年的第三季度发布的移动操作系统。虽然还没有正式发布,但在Google的开发者会议上,已经发布了一些关于Android 13的最新消息和详情。Android 13将会着重于数字隐私和安全性,包括更多的隐私保护和安全性特性。同时,Andro...